Cincinnati vs Phoenix-Mesa-Chandler

Fair Market Rent Comparison — HUD 2025 Data

Quick Answer

Cincinnati is 25% cheaper for renters. A 2-bedroom rents for $924/mo vs $1,158/mo in Phoenix-Mesa-Chandler — saving $2,808/year.

Rent by Unit Size

Unit SizeCincinnatiPhoenix-Mesa-ChandlerDifference
Studio$616$752$136
1 Bedroom$741$943$202
2 Bedrooms$924$1,158$234
3 Bedrooms$1,099$1,495$396
4 Bedrooms$1,252$1,715$463
Median Income$47,367$62,754$15,387
